Frequently Asked Questions about Rent Specials Newton Center Apartments

How much is the average rent for a Rent Specials Newton Center Apartment?

The average rent for a Rent Specials Apartment in Newton Center is $4,807.

What is the largest Rent Specials Newton Center Apartment for rent?

Today's Rent Specials apartment with the most square footage in Newton Center is a 2,800 square feet unit starting from $5,700 at 127 Nonantum St.

What is the average size for Newton Center Rent Specials Apartments for rent?

The average size for a Rent Specials rental in Newton Center is currently at 1,430 sq ft.
